The drug boosted the efficiency of standard mesothelioma chemotherapy in recent lab tests.

According to researchers at the University of Torino, dasatinib (brand name Sprycel) inhibits specific enzymes that play a crucial role in the growth and proliferation of cancer cells. As quickly as it was applied to mesothelioma cells along along with pemetrexed, the outcomes were encouraging.
“Dasatinib procedure impaired cells migration, and the 2 sequential and co-administration along with PEM [pemetrexed] greatly increased apoptosis,” reports oncologist Dr. Valentina Monica, whose name appears very first about the paper.
The group concluded that dasatinib has actually the electricity to make mesothelioma cells much more sensitive to pemetrexed, which can potentially enhance outcomes and expand mesothelioma survival.
